OsteoMed, MedCom Advisors partner on new spine system

OsteoMed signed an agreement with MedCom Advisors for the co-marketing of the PrimaLOK SP Interspinous Fusion System and the development of the MI-Port Fusion Procedure.

Advertisement

As part of the agreement, MedCom will provide training and protocol development for the use of the PrimaLOK SP in MIS fusion procedures.

 

“The collaboration of MedCom and OsteoMed has already led to the development of the MI-Port Fusion Procedure for minimally invasive lumbar interbody fusion. This spine procedure can be performed efficiently, cost effectively and reproducibly with a very short learning curve compared with other MIS techniques. This spine procedure is ideal for the ambulatory surgical environment,” said Gordon Donald, MD, managing physician for MedCom.
